File relating to commemorative activities to mark the journey to Galway in 1477 by Christopher Columbus and its impact of Columbus' later journey to America. Includes letter from Professor Colm Ó hEocha, President of University College Galway (NUIG) seeking expressions of interest to events at UCG to mark the event; Letters between Rynne and others discussing the discovery of America and notes by Rynne on the subject. Also press cuttings of letters to the press on the topic.

Material in this subseries relates to various commemorations and includes correspondence, programmes, booklets, flyers, cuttings and minutes.

G60/17/3/1 includes material relating to the Thomas Davis and Young Ireland centenary commemorations, 1945, and the 75th anniversary of the Ballyseedy Massacre, 1998. The subsequent four files contain material relating to the 50th, 75th and 100th anniversaries of the 1916 Easter Rising.

File of press cuttings and letters to the press regarding the wording around an image published in the Irish times (4 April 1968) which when published was captioned "De Valera reviewing anti-Treaty I.R.A. units". Michael Rynne writes to correct this description to say "President de Valera Reviewing General Michael Brennan's East Clare Brigade of the Irish Volunteers and dates the photograph to 4 Dec 1921 and adds that he himself is present in the image. Numerous other letters and conversations around the image are present. The image was often published with other captions and copies of same are included.
